Investment thesis
Invests at Series B+ (Series A+ style), scales climate-tech from product to industrial deployment, leverages Southern Europe climate expertise and Europe–Latin America bridge, with €2–8M initial, up to €20M follow-on.

Frequently asked questions
- What stage does Seaya invest at?
- Seaya invests at the Seed, Series A, Series B, Series C, Growth, Late Stage stages.
- What is Seaya's typical check size?
- Seaya typically writes checks of $2.2M – $16.2M.
- What sectors does Seaya focus on?
- Seaya focuses on Cleantech, Consumer, Data & Infrastructure, Energy, Enterprise Software, Fintech, FoodTech, Hardware, Media & Entertainment, New Materials, SaaS, Sector Agnostic.
- Where is Seaya located?
- Seaya is headquartered in Madrid, ES.
- Does Seaya lead rounds?
- Seaya typically participates in rounds rather than leading them.
